Ingredients

- 2 white fish fillets (cod, tilapia, or haddock)
- 2 small potatoes
- 1 cup broccoli florets
- 1 cup cauliflower florets
- 1 small carrot
- Olive oil or butter
- Fresh or dried herbs (parsley or thyme)
- Garlic (optional)
Instructions
- Boil potato slices in salted water for 10-12 minutes until fork-tender. Drain and toss with olive oil or butter and parsley.
- Steam broccoli, cauliflower, and carrot in a steamer basket for 5-7 minutes until vibrant but tender. Season lightly with salt.
- Season fish fillets with salt, pepper, garlic (if using), and herbs. Heat olive oil in a nonstick pan over medium heat and cook fish for 3-4 minutes per side until golden and flaky.
- Plate the fish alongside the potatoes and steamed veggies, garnishing with extra herbs if desired.
- Prep Time: 10 minutes
- Cook Time: 15 minutes
